When to Use Menulis
Menulis excels as a display font. It's best suited for headlines, logos, and short phrases where visual impact matters. Its handwritten style makes it ideal for packaging titles, social media graphics, and website banners. However, it's not the best choice for long blocks of text due to its decorative nature.
That said, with careful spacing and sizing, Menulis can work in smaller formats like product tags or stickers. Just keep in mind that readability is key—especially on mobile screens or printed materials where space is limited.
Pairing Menulis with Other Fonts
One of the strengths of Menulis is how well it pairs with other fonts. For a balanced look, try pairing it with a clean sans serif like Lato or Montserrat. This creates contrast while maintaining visual harmony. For a more elegant feel, pair it with a serif font like Georgia or Playfair Display.
If you're going for a more creative or artistic vibe, consider pairing Menulis with another script or handwritten font. Just be mindful of not overcomplicating the design. A simple combination can go a long way in making your brand feel cohesive and professional.
Considerations Before Using Menulis
Before using Menulis in your designs, check the available styles and file formats. Make sure it includes the necessary weights and alternates for your specific needs. Also, verify that it supports the languages you'll be using, especially if you're targeting international audiences.
Commercial licensing is another important factor. Ensure that the font license covers the intended use, whether it's for your own business, client projects, or digital downloads. This helps avoid any legal issues down the line.
